Shimokubo
Shimokubo is a locality in Fujioka Shi, Gunma. Shimokubo is situated nearby to the quarter Yano, as well as near the locality Inume.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Nagatoro is a town located in Saitama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 March 2021, the town had an estimated population of 6,838 in 2894 households and a population density of 220 persons per km2. Nagatoro is situated 8 km east of Shimokubo.

Minano is a town located in Saitama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 January 2021, the town had an estimated population of 9,497 in 3994 households and a population density of 150 persons per km2. The total area of the town is 63.74 square kilometres. Minano is situated 10 km southeast of Shimokubo.
